Used truck glove boxes & dashboard storage compartments

Glove boxes and dashboard storage compartments give drivers a practical place to store documents, tools and everyday items inside the cab. In heavy trucks these compartments are usually integrated into the dashboard, centre console or passenger side of the cab, and are designed to match the shape, colour and durability of the original interior. A complete glove box typically includes the storage bin itself, the lid and hinges, and sometimes a latch or lock.

Why glove boxes & cabin storage matter

Even though glove boxes and storage compartments are not moving parts, they play an important role in day-to-day operation of a truck:

  • organisation – provide a safe place to store paperwork, tachograph rolls, tools, chargers and other small items so the cab stays tidy;
  • driver comfort – reduce clutter around the dashboard and bunk area, improving comfort on long trips and nights away;
  • appearance – intact storage compartments help the cab interior look smart and professional, which is important for fleet image and resale value;
  • safety – secure lids and compartments help prevent loose items from becoming hazards under braking or in an accident.

Typical reasons to replace a glove box or storage compartment

Common reasons to order parts from the Glove Boxes category include:

  • broken hinges or latches that prevent the glove box from opening or closing properly;
  • cracked or missing lids after years of use, impact or previous repairs;
  • damaged mounting points that stop the compartment from sitting firmly in the dash or bunk area;
  • heavily scratched or stained plastics that spoil the look of the cab interior;
  • replacing non-original or improvised storage with a correct OEM glove box or storage unit.

How to choose the correct glove box or compartment

To make sure you order the right glove box or storage compartment for your truck, always check:

  • OEM part number on the existing compartment or in your parts catalogue;
  • truck brand, model and cab type – for example DAF XF106 Super Space Cab, MAN TGX Euro 6, Volvo FH4 Globetrotter, Mercedes Actros MP4;
  • position in the cab – passenger-side dash, centre dash, above-windscreen storage or under-bunk compartment;
  • trim colour and texture to ensure a good match with surrounding panels;
  • mounting method – screw points, clips and brackets used to secure the unit in the dashboard or wall;
  • whether the part includes lid, hinges and latch, or if you will reuse any of these from your existing compartment.
